Currently, if you don’t have one, you should consider the extra cost … WebBitmac is manufactured by removing the tar and replacing it with bitumen. This creates a new surface which is more similar to asphalt. However the difference between bitumen and asphalt is that there is a far greater concentration of sand and filler in bitmac. Asphalt has a much denser blend of aggregates bound together with bitumen. – a ...

Peter Fitzpatrick Ltd. have been supplying quality asphalt products for over … can a chest infection cause nauseaWebThe bitmac wearing course with hard stone aggregate should be at least 30 mm thick after being well compacted with heavy machinery. The size of the stone aggregate is determined by the intended use of the tarmac surface. If it is a foot path or domestic driveway for cars only, 6 mm aggregate is acceptable. fish city burleson texasWebAverage: £45 – £90 per sqm, depending on size.
